As EHC Olten announces, Daniel Steiner will have the opportunity to earn himself a contract with the NLB team for the upcoming season. The forward had parted ways with EHC Biel in June.

The 35-year-old forward would have had a contract in place with the Seelanders for the 2016-17 season, but he and Kevin Schläpfer were no longer on the same page and so the agreement was dissolved in June.

Steiner joined EHC Biel in the 2015-16 season and appeared in 56 games for them, scoring 17 goals and ten assists. He will play in tonight's game against the Iserlohn Roosters. (mso)
